SETTLEMENT AGREEMENT <br />This Settlement Agreement is entered into this ~ of June, 1999 by and between <br />Board of County Commissioners of Pitkin County, Colorado, Plaintiff and Third Party <br />Defendant ("Pitkin County") and Thomas Cazl Oken, Pitkin County Treasurer, Plaintiff; Mid- <br />Continent Resources, Inc., a Delawaze corporation ("MCR") and Louis M. LaGiglia, Creditors' <br />Trustee under Bankruptcy Plan of Liquidation ("Trustee"), Defendants and Third-Party <br />Plaintiffs, MidCon Realty, LLC, a Delawaze limited liability company {"MidCon"}, Third-Party <br />Plaintiff and State of Colorado, Department of Natural Resources, Division of Minerals and <br />Geology, Third-Party Defendant ("DMG"). <br />RECITALS: <br />A. From the 1950s until 1991, MCR conducted coal mining operations in Coal <br />Basin. The coal mining took place primarily in Pitkin County, but also involved land in <br />Gunnison County and Garfield County, Colorado. <br />B. In 1492, MCR filed bankruptcy in U.S. Bankruptcy Court in Colorado. MCR's <br />Second Amended Plan of Liquidation was approved by the Bankruptcy Court on April 11, 1994. <br />C. The Liquidation Plan called for funding of reclamation of Coal Basin through <br />liquidation of MCR's property in Coal Basin. DMG appeazed in MCR's bankruptcy case and <br />filed a proof of claim for reclamation costs. _ <br />D. MCR began reclamation operations in Coal Basin in 1991 and continued <br />reclamation in 1992 and 1993. In 1994, DMG took over reclamation operations and has <br />continued to perform reclamation since that time. <br />£. The Parties to this Settlement Agreement aze parties to a lawsuit in District Court <br />Pitkin County, Colorado, Case No. 97-CV-131-1 ("Lawsuit"). <br />.. <br />';ii. <br />~v>'~"H. <br />
